在Python编程中,文本输入是一个基础且常用的操作。然而,对于不同场景和需求,文本输入的方式也会有所不同。本文将介绍三种常见的Python文本输入方法,帮助您轻松应对各种输入难题。方法一:使用inp...
在Python编程中,文本输入是一个基础且常用的操作。然而,对于不同场景和需求,文本输入的方式也会有所不同。本文将介绍三种常见的Python文本输入方法,帮助您轻松应对各种输入难题。
input()函数是Python中最常用的文本输入方法。它允许用户从标准输入(通常是键盘)接收一行文本。
user_input = input("请输入您的名字:")
print("您好,", user_input)input()函数默认接收的输入为字符串类型。input()后进行类型转换。在Python 2中,raw_input()函数与input()函数类似,但raw_input()返回的是字符串类型。
user_input = raw_input("请输入您的名字:")
print("您好,", user_input)raw_input()函数在Python 3中已被弃用,建议使用input()函数。input()函数类似,raw_input()也默认接收字符串类型的输入。对于需要从文件中读取文本的场景,可以使用Python的文件操作功能。
with open("example.txt", "r") as file: content = file.read() print(content)read()方法会读取整个文件内容,如果文件较大,可能导致内存溢出。通过以上三种方法,您可以轻松地在Python中进行文本输入。在实际应用中,根据具体需求选择合适的方法,可以大大提高编程效率。希望本文能帮助您解决文本输入难题。